    Bio Ethanol Fire

    A bio-ethanol fire is a reliable and safe way to heat your house without a chimney or flue. If properly used, biofuel fireplaces emit CO2 and water vapour and do not harm the indoor air quality.

    It is important to follow manufacturer's instructions and safety guidelines. It is also important to keep all flammable substances away from the fire, and ensure adequate ventilation.

    Environmentally friendly

    Bio ethanol fires can be an environmentally friendly alternative to traditional wood-burning fireplaces and log burners. These fuels are made from renewable plants and have a lower carbon footprint than fossil fuels. They also require less maintenance and can be utilized in a variety of environments. Additionally, they don't emit any harmful by-products during combustion, making them a great choice for your home or office.

    Ethanol is a renewable source of energy that is produced through sugar fermentation in biomass crops like corn and maize. It is regarded as carbon-neutral, since the CO2 released in the process of burning is similar to the amount absorbed by plants during the process of production. This makes it more environmentally sustainable than fossil fuels such as natural gas, which will run out in 53 years when production continues at the current rate.

    Easy to install

    In contrast to wood burning fires and gas fires, which require a chimney or a flue to safely vent smoke and gases from the home, a bio-ethanol fireplace doesn't need a vent and can be installed in any room. It's a clean and safe fuel that can be used even in homes with pets or small children. The bioethanol fireplace is also more economical and versatile than other types of fires. It produces beautiful natural flames, and does not emit harmful fumes or smoke.

    Installing a bio-ethanol fireplace is easy, especially when there is an existing fireplace or wall in the room you wish to install it. It can be affixed to solid walls as well as plaster boards or wood panels with the correct installation kit. It can also be installed in an opening, recessed wall, or even a structure. However it is important to follow the instructions of the manufacturer. It is also possible to place it on an unfinished glass surface or onto an specially designed, heat and scratch-resistant base.

    When installing a bio ethanol fireplace, make sure that it is mounted securely to the structure or wall in which you intend to place it. The fire should not be positioned near anything flammable, such as furniture or curtains. It should also be a safe distance from televisions and mirrors that hang on walls. The recommended minimum distances from the combustible materials can vary based on the product. Be sure to go through the user's instructions.
